Chairman & Director
President and CEO
Steven R. Garman
Mr. Garman joined the Board of Directors in June of 2003 and brings the Company over
35 years of business experience in the international corporate environment. He has
a very diversified management background including senior executive positions in
varied industries such as health care services, high tech medical devices, computer
products, OEM manufacturing, and sports and recreation. Mr. Garman has held
multi-million dollar P & L responsibility with the Olympus Corporation and served as
CEO and President of a pre-IPO start-up. He has been named a member of the Board of
Directors of multiple start-up corporations, worked as an international business
consultant and has served as Managing General Partner for a private investment
group.

Director
Allan D. Graves
Mr. Graves graduated from the University of British Columbia in 1983
with a BASc in Electrical Engineering. He has gained extensive technical
experience working as a hardware and software design engineer for several
companies over the last 20 years. His experience has covered a full range
of product development in the areas of industrial process control,
digital audio electronics, 1.8Ghz wireless and cable repeaters for CDMA
cell phone communications, and of course vending and Smart card payment
systems.

CFO and COO
Robert McLean
Before joining QI Systems, Mr. Robert McLean was Executive Vice President of Business Development and Global Account Management for Teleplan International of the Netherlands, a $300M publicly traded technology company. Prior to his appointment as Vice President of Teleplan, Bob served as the Treasurer of Teleplan's American operations. Preceding this assignment, Mr. McLean held the position of Senior Vice President of Finance and Chief Financial Officer with PC Service Source of Dallas, Texas, a large publicly traded independent computer parts distributor.
Earlier in Mr. McLean's career he was Vice President - Planning and Development of Computer City, Inc., a $2B retail subsidiary of Radio Shack, Inc., and was Director of Planning and Analysis for CompuCom Systems, Inc. Prior to entering the technology sector, he was the General Manager of a commercial aviation component repair facility owned by Aviall, Inc. For nearly 11 years, Mr. McLean held various financial and operational positions with Aviall and its predecessor company, Ryder Inc.'s Aviation Services Division. Mr. McLean started his career as an auditor with the Miami office of PriceWaterhouseCoopers.
Bob has a Bachelor of Science - Accounting degree from Drexel University, Philadelphia, PA and a Masters of Business Administration - Finance degree from the University of Miami. He is a member of the American and Florida Institutes of Certified Public Accountants.
